Re: Dover In Motion
« Reply #32 on: July 10, 2024, 09:03:06 AM »
Nice appearing race, but he did get a great post and a real fast pace to close into. Not to mention that what he faced was with a couple exceptions not Open class horses.

Purses there are insane.  The purse in that race of $50,000 was more than they handled in the betting pool for it. 

I didn't examine all the races, but I believe the handle there is so low overall that the purse to handle ratio is not like any other track in existence.
